Chapter 854 I Don't Want to Go to Jail

Mrs. Miller pulled Anna aside when she saw Jimmy not far away.

"Anna, who is that man? He looks like he's rich. Can you borrow money from him? We can pay himback when we have the money," Mrs. Miller whispered in Anna's ear.

"No way," Anna replied without hesitation, refusing her mother's proposal.

She couldn't imagine how she would ask Jimmy for money.

"What are we going to do then? Are you going to let your father die? Your father loves you the mostand if you don't find a solution, it will be all for nothing," Mrs. Miller continued to pressure Anna.

Just as Anna was hesitating, Jimmy walked up to them.

"I've arranged for the doctor to prepare for surgery tomorrow morning and remove the tumor in hisbrain," Jimmy said in a low voice.

Mrs. Miller looked shocked and kept looking between Anna and Jimmy with disbelief written on herface.

"Anna, is he your boyfriend?" Mrs. Miller asked with curiosity in her voice but Anna immediatelyshook her head.

"If he isn't your boyfriend, then why would he pay for your father's medical expenses? Are you... areyou..." Mrs. Miller trailed off.

Anna had read her mother's mind and looked helpless.

"I'm your daughter and I never thought about selling myself out. He... he is my boss." Afterhesitating briefly, Anna talked about their relationship.

"Just your boss?" Mrs. Miller questioned with confusion etched on her face but before she could askmore questions, two police officers approached them

"We understand the situation but we need both of you to come down to the station and give usdetailed statements." One of the officers stated matter-of-factly

Mrs. Miller knew that her son couldn't escape being caught so despite loving him unconditionallyfear filled every inch of herself at this moment.

"Officer, will my son be sentenced?" She asked anxiously

"The court will convict based on his circumstances." The officer replied, causing Mrs. Miller'scomplexion turn pale.

Anna didn't care about Gavyn's fate. After all, he was a brother who wanted to sell her to pay off hisdebts. Did he really deserve her sympathy?

"Anna, you must not let your elder brother go to jail, otherwise his life will be ruined. You... you mustsave him."

Mrs. Miller's request left a bitter smile on Anna's lips.

"You seem to have forgotten how he treated me. Besides, the police are involved and I... can't savehim," Anna said expressionlessly.

Under the urging of the police, she came to Jimmy and took a deep breath. Her eyes, as clear asspring water, fell upon him.

"Can ... you take care of my dad for me? I'll come back as soon as I can after recording mystatement."

There was a strong plea in Anna's stunningly beautiful eyes.

At this moment, besides saving Jimmy, she didn't know who to ask for help.

Jimmy opened his sexy lips and said slowly, "I've arranged for a nurse to go to the hospital roomand take care of your father, I'll send you to the police station."

Anna hesitated for a moment, but eventually agreed to Jimmy's proposal.

She carefully supported her mother, whose legs were weak, and walked out of the hospital.

Mrs. Miller was surprised when she saw Jimmy's global limited edition sports car.

"Anna, you... you need to get this man." Mrs. Miller whispered in Anna's ear.

Anna was rendered speechless as she saw the gleam of greed in her mother's eyes.

After helping Mrs. Miller into the car, Anna sat beside her until...

"Reduce swelling," Jimmy said in a low and cold voice.

At the sight of Anna's visibly red and swollen cheeks, he felt the urge to send the man who'd hit herinto hell.

When Anna saw the ice cube in her hand, her star-like eyes sparkled with light.

Perhaps he was not as much of a bastard as she imagined him to be.

"Thank you," Anna whispered as she gently placed the ice cube on her swollen cheek.

When she came to the police station, Anna realized that those loan sharks had done things thatwere really cruel, abducting and selling young girls, beating people up and seriously injuring them,and every one of them was heartbreaking.

Although Anna doesn't have much knowledge of the law, she is certain that Waylon and his gangwill receive a severe sentence.

Serves you right.

"Mom, save me, I don't want to go to jail," cried Mrs. Miller's son, Gavyn.

Mrs. Miller felt heartbroken seeing her son in tears.

"Anna, you have to help me. I'm your brother; you can't just leave me here. Please think of a way forme to get out of this place," Gavyn pleaded with Anna when he saw her.

"Anna, I never kidnapped any girls or caused anyone serious injury. You have to believe yourbrother," Gavyn said quickly as he was afraid Anna would ignore him completely.

Despite everything that had happened between them, Anna still had a soft spot for her older brotherand couldn't bear seeing him in pain like this. Plus, Mrs. Miller kept begging Anna for help on theside which made it even harder for Anna to decide what she should do next.

"Anna, your brother knows he was wrong; please forgive him this time around and help him out ofhere."

Gavyn saw hope in his sister's eyes when she began showing signs of wavering under his pleasand apologies.

The police took Gavyn away while Mrs. Miller wept uncontrollably.

"Anna! Go beg that man over there! The chief is talking with him right now! You must go ask him forhelp!"

Mrs. Miller whispered furiously at her daughter who seemed unmoved by the situation unfoldingbefore their eyes.

"Your brother is the only son we have left in our family! How will he survive if he goes to jail? Yourfather will be so angry if he finds out!"

Knowing Anna cared so much about Mr. Miller, Mrs. Miller used him as a chip to negotiate withAnna.

Under pressure from her mother, Anna dragged her heavy feet to Jimmy.

Jimmy's eyes fell on Anna's face which had become less swollen.

"Thank you for taking my mom and me here."novelbin

Anna had difficulty in proposing that request, so she could only awkwardly look at Jimmy.

Jimmy nodded and walked towards the police station entrance.

"Anna, do you really want to piss me off! Go chase after him."

Seeing her daughter stand motionlessly, Mrs. Miller felt really furious.
